NDC National Organizer and 3rd Vice Chairman, Joseph Yamin and Abanga Yakubu respectively have denied tacitly allegations that they are neck deep in galamsey activities.

The Attorney-General and Minister for Justice, Dr. Dominic Akuritinga Ayine on Thursday directed the Economic and Organised Crime Office (EOCO) to launch a full-scale investigation into alleged illegal mining activities involving Joseph Yamin, the ruling NDC’s National Organiser, and Yakubu Abanga, National Vice Chairman.

In a letter dated Tuesday, July 15, 2025, the Attorney-General instructed EOCO to invite the two individuals named in recent reports for interrogation over their suspected involvement in unauthorised mining operations, commonly referred to as galamsey.

But the duo, in a separate media interviews with the Exposè, have denied tacitly the allegations being leveled against them.

“I have never being engaged in any mining activity at any point. This allegation is baseless, they are malicious and calculated attempt to tarnish my hard earned reputation”, Mr. Abanga fumed.

Meanwhile the duo have vowed to honour any invitation extended to them even though as at going to press, they had not received yet any official invitation from the Investigation bodies.
